Document::OOXML::ContentTypes - Part to content-type mapping for OOXML
version 0.181410
my $ct = Document::OOXML::ContentTypes->new_from_xml($xml_data); say "The content type of /word/document.xml is " . $ct->get_content_type_for_part('/word/document.xml');
OOXML files contain a file named '[Content_Types].xml' that describes the content-types of all the other files in the package.
This class implements a way to look up the content-type for a file name, given the contents of that file.
Creates a new Document::OOXML::ContentTypes instance from the contents of the /[Content-Types].xml file from an OOXML file.
/[Content-Types].xml
Returns the content-type of the part with the specified name.
